The “Festival of Lights,” Deepavali, was celebrated with great warmth, serenity, and hope on the evening of October 21st, 2025, across all M.I.O Hospital locations Pumpwell, Karangalpady, Udupi, and Thirthahalli.
Deepavali, which symbolises the victory of light over darkness, carries a profound meaning in a hospital environment. It is a moment to illuminate hope and positivity for our patients and their families as they navigate their healing journeys.
Illuminating the Hospital with Festive Cheer
The MIO units were transformed with traditional festive decorations. Staff members across all departments participated enthusiastically in the celebrations:
Luminous Displays: Hundreds of earthen lamps (diyas) and lights were carefully placed, casting a warm glow over the common areas and entrances. This act of lighting the lamps symbolised our collective prayer for the health and swift recovery of every individual under our care.
Art and Colour: Beautiful and intricate rangolis, created with vibrant colours and flowers, adorned the reception and waiting areas, injecting a festive spirit of peace and prosperity into the hospital environment.
The celebration was dedicated to creating a comforting atmosphere, easing the anxieties of patients and their caregivers by bringing light and joy of the festival indoors.
